TradingView доступен в браузерной версии и как десктопное приложение для Windows, macOS и Linux. В этой статье рассказываем, как скачать TradingView и установить его на ПК, рассматриваем возможности десктопного приложения и условия использования. Обзор на браузерную версию TradingView вы найдете здесь.
История котировок Форекс
Архив котировок представляет собой историю движения цены того или иного актива за довольно продолжительное время, которое порой может достигать десятилетий.
Большинство брокеров Форекс в качестве дополнительного сервиса предоставляют своим клиентам историю котировок для МТ4, куда входят не только основные валютные пары, но и драгоценные металлы, вроде серебра или золота.
Для чего нужна история котировок Форекс?
Без архива котировок Forex станет невозможным тестирование торговых советников, стратегий, индикаторов. Ведь для их тестирования необходимо большое количество баров не только за текущий год, но и за предыдущие года.
КАК СКАЧАТЬ КОТИРОВКИ АКЦИЙ С МОСКОВСКОЙ БИРЖИ. СКАЧИВАЕМ КОТИРОВКИ С ПОМОЩЬЮ PYTHON
Так, что история котировок для MetaTrader 4 хранится непосредственно в самом терминале. Однако она может быть не полной, скажем всего за несколько лет. С другой стороны всегда можно в Сети найти архивы котировок в свободном доступе, скачать их и тем самым только увеличить исторические данные по ценам активов. Кроме того, существуют тиковые котировки. Просто так их получить не удастся, только путем самостоятельного сбора.
Ниже речь пойдет об истории котировок для Metatrader 4, ведь она позволяет сделать любую торговлю на Форекс более полной и проверенной.
Как мы упоминали выше, любое ознакомление с торговым роботом либо индикатором лежит через проверку их работоспособности (эффективности) на тестере стратегий. Кстати, паттерны Price Action также проверяются на графиках с глубокой историей котировок.
Индикаторы Форекс хорошо работают только в том случае, когда в архив полон котировок. В противном же случае будут совершаться просчеты, и алгоритм торгового инструмента будет казаться недостаточно верным.
Так, что история котировок Форекс должна быть подходящей и полной.
Естественно, каждый трейдер торгует по-своему. Некоторые уделяют торговле много времени и относятся к заключению каждой сделки с большой серьёзностью. Но есть и те, кто недолго думая открывает сделки.
Как скопировать котировки с МТ4?
Бывает такое, что трейдеру необходимо скопировать котировки из торгового терминала MetaTrader 4 в Excel либо какое-нибудь другое приложение. В этом поможет технология Dynamic Data Exchange (DDE).
Итак, в МТ4 чтобы начать экспортировать котировки, нужно нажать на “Сервис” – “Настройки”. Выбираем вкладку “Сервер” и ставим галочку напротив “Разрешить DDE сервер”, потом жмём “Ок”.
После этого в таблице Microsoft Excel можно вписать формулу:
Затем нажать на копку “Enter”.
Рисунок 1. Котировки Форекс в Microsoft Excel.
Кстати, вместо BID можно указывать TIME, HIGH, LOW, ASK или даже QUOTE. Актив EUR/USD также может быть другим.
Как загрузить котировки в МТ4?
Для того, чтобы загрузить котировки финансовых активов в торговый терминал, сначала понадобиться скачать архив котировок для МТ4.
Итак, заходим в меню “Сервис” и выбираем “Архив котировок”, либо вызываем его с помощью функциональной клавиши F2 на клавиатуре.
Рисунок 2. Вызываем архив котировок.
После этого автоматически должна появиться история котировок Форекс. В этом окне можно выбрать валютную пару и таймфрейм.
Рисунок 3. Окно архива котировок.
Когда выбор актива и временного периода выбран, жмем “Загрузить”. Пройдет некоторое время пока котировки добавятся. Затем закрываем диалоговое окно, и смело тестируем индикаторы и автоматические роботы.
Как импортировать котировки в МетаТрейдер 4?
Как оказалось найти детализированные котировки для МТ4 достаточно сложное дело. Гораздо проще отыскать историю котировок Форекс для торговой площадки MetaStock.
Отметим, что форматы предоставления данных по котировкам в MetaStock и МТ4 очень похожи. Вместе с тем, они нуждаются в некоторой корректировке.
Чтобы импортировать котировки, понадобиться выполнить следующие шаги:
- Выйти из терминала МТ4 (закрыть его).
- Удаляем все файлы с окончанием .hst, относящиеся к тому или иному активу в папке терминала history\. То есть, например, у нас стоит задача импортировать архив котировок для МТ4 для актива GBP/USD, тогда под удаление попадут файлы: GBPUSD43200.hst, GBPUSD30.hst, GBPUSD1440.hst, GBPUSD 1.hst, GBPUSD15.hst, GBPUSD10080.hst, GBPUSD5.hst, GBPUSD240.hst и GBPUSD60.hst.
- Загружаем терминал МТ4.
- Открываем «Архив котировок» и выбираем в нем необходимый актив и таймфрейм пары GBP/USD, как показано на скриншоте ниже.
Рисунок 4. Архив котировок GBP/USD.
Последним шагом будет нажать на «Импорт», появится ещё одно окно. Затем нажимаем на «Обзор», выбираем путь к распакованным файлам:
Рисунок 5. Импорт архива котировок GBP/USD.
После вышеуказанных действий архив котировок для МТ4 загрузится в терминал, что позволит выполнять тестирование торговых стратегий и советников с большой точностью.
Отметим, что временной период М1 выступает базовым для всех таймфреймов, поскольку по его данным можно провести синтез истории котировок для остальных таймфреймов, в том числе, нестандартных.
Также минутный временной период даёт возможность рассматривать формирование японской свечи более старшего таймфрейма. Представьте себе, если для той или иной часовой свечи просто отсутствует минутная история изменения цены, тогда можно только догадываться, каким образом, будет развиваться ситуация с формированием свечи на H1.
Вот почему, при тестировании торговых тактик на часовых таймфреймах обязательно рекомендуют загружать историю котировок Форекс того или иного финансового актива с таймфреймом М1. Абсолютной точности он не предоставит, для этого понадобятся история тиков, но приближенную точность он всё-таки предоставит.
Важные моменты
Ниже мы расскажем о наиболее важных нюансах, зная которые каждый трейдер сможет сэкономить много времени перед тем, как загружать архив котировок для МТ4.
Закачивать следует исключительно минутные котировки, так как именно по ним будет переучет всех остальных таймфреймов.
Не у каждого русского Форекс брокера есть в наличии история котировок в архиве. Также не факт, что они находятся в хорошем состоянии. Иными словами они могут быть с “дырами” (цены не за 1 или 5 минут, а за дни и месяцы). Всегда уточняйте этот вопрос у технической поддержки.
Конечно, они могут предложить клиенту в отсутствие своего архива, скачать котировки от MetaQuotes – разработчика торгового терминала МТ4,5. Кстати, у них котировки также “дырявые”.
Выходит, что торговля у брокера будет вестись по одним ценам, а тестировать индикаторы, и советники будем по другим ценовым значениям.
Что предпринять в таком случае? Есть одно решение! Большинство профессиональных трейдеров хвалят архивы историй котировок у одного из старейших брокеров Форекс Альпари. У них котировки, что называется “без дыр”. Это не реклама, торговать можете у любого брокера, но тестировать стратегии с торговыми советниками лучше всего именно у них.
Заключение
В этом материале мы рассказали, что такое история котировок, зачем её нужно загружать в торговый терминал МТ4. Показали, как импортировать котировки в Метатрейдер 4. Также мы дали советы, у какого брокера Форекс лучше всего брать архив минутных котировок для любых валютных пар.
Все самое лучшее от Академии
только нашим подписчикам
Источник: academyfx.ru
Как импортировать текущий курс криптовалюты в Google Таблицы
Курсы криптовалют меняются практически каждую минуту, причем некоторые колеблются не на один десяток или даже сотню процентов. Иногда требуется отследить текущий курс определенной криптовалюты прямо в Google Таблицах, чтобы выполнить необходимые расчеты, посчитать доходы или убытки.
В рамках этой статьи я расскажу, как справиться с этой задачей двумя разными способами.
Метод 1: Использование функции GOOGLEFINANCE
Использование функции GOOGLEFINANCE уже описано в другой моей статье – в ней рассказывается о конвертировании денежных единиц, не связанных с криптовалютой. Вы можете использовать ее и для биткоина или других токенов, о которых знает Гугл. Для этого можете ввести в поисковике запрос, например, «SHIB to RUB». Если появится форма от Google, значит, этот способ можно использовать для конкретной криптовалюты.
Вам будет достаточно узнать сокращение и в формуле указать, например, BTCRUB, чтобы получить соответствующий курс, который будет время от времени обновляться автоматически, отображая актуальное состояние котировок.
В противном случае, когда форма с котировками отсутствует, понадобится обратиться к следующему методу с импортом XML, о котором я расскажу в следующей инструкции.
Комьюнити теперь в Телеграм
Подпишитесь и будьте в курсе последних IT-новостей
Метод 2: Использование функции IMPORTXML
Этот метод более гибкий, поскольку вы можете самостоятельно выбрать сайт или биржу, с которой будете переносить котировки криптовалюты в Google Таблицу с автоматическим обновлением. Второе преимущество данного варианта перед предыдущим – нет ограничений в плане доступных токенов, ведь далеко не все из них представлены Гуглом. В качестве примера я взял сайт CoinMarketCup, поэтому покажу, как получить необходимое значение для дальнейшего использования в таблице.
- Откройте данный сайт или любой другой, отыщите в списке требуемый токен и перейдите на его страницу.
- Сайт предлагает выбрать валюту, курс с которой необходимо отображать. Отыщите подходящий вариант и дождитесь загрузки страницы.
- На русскоязычной версии сайта CoinMarketCup цена автоматически отображается в рублях. Выделите надпись, щелкните по ней правой кнопкой мыши и через контекстное меню перейдите в просмотр кода элемента.
- Вам необходимо узнать, к какому классу относится это значение. Если будете использовать данный сайт, можете пропустить этот этап, поскольку далее можно будет скопировать мою формулу и вставить ее в свою таблицу. При работе с другими площадками понадобится самостоятельно узнать класс и уже модернизировать формулу под себя.
Теперь перейдите к таблице, выделите для формулы пустую ячейку. Вставьте туда формулу, если собираетесь использовать тот же сайт, о котором я говорю:
Соответственно, «bitcoin» нужно заменить на название того токена, курс которого вы желаете отслеживать. Обратите внимание на то, что при работе с другими площадками название класса понадобится заменить на актуальное, чтобы считывание данных происходило корректно.
Вы можете убрать приставку «ru/» из данной формулы, чтобы получить отображение курса выбранной криптовалюты к доллару.
Дополнительно отмечу, что вы можете использовать ссылку формата https://coinmarketcap.com/currencies/bitcoin/btc/eur/, заменив необходимые названия валют. Это более гибкий вариант, не привязанный к языку страницы и вашей геопозиции.
Разработчики в документации более детально описывают функцию IMPORTXML, которая и является основной при получении необходимых сведений. Вы можете ознакомиться с ее синтаксисом самостоятельно и редактировать под личные потребности.
Если сайт, который вы используете как средство слежения за курсами криптовалют, предоставляет свое API, его можно импортировать в Google Таблицу и получить примерно такой же результат. Я не рассматриваю этот вариант, поскольку для обычных пользователей он не является приоритетным, к тому же значительно он сложнее в реализации, нежели те два метода, которые были рассмотрены выше.
Источник: timeweb.com